Benefits of Investing in SCHD
Before diving deeper into how to utilize the calculator, it's vital to understand why many investors gravitate towards schd dividend estimate. Here are some of its noteworthy benefits:
- High Dividend Yield: schd ex dividend date calculator normally uses a higher yield than many traditional equity investments.
- Concentrate On Quality Stocks: SCHD invests primarily in high-quality U.S. companies with strong fundamentals and a history of consistent dividend payments.
- Diversity: As an ETF, SCHD provides diversification, lowering private stock danger.
- Tax Efficiency: Investors might gain from tax benefits, as certified dividends are frequently taxed at a lower rate.

Historical Dividend Performance
For a more concrete understanding, let's have a look at the historic dividends of SCHD over the last 5 years:
| Year | Dividends Paid per Share | Dividend Yield |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| ₤ 1.75 | 3.5% |
| 2020 | ₤ 1.86 | 4.0% |
| 2021 | ₤ 1.99 | 3.9% |
| 2022 | ₤ 2.15 | 3.6% |
| 2023 | ₤ 2.33 | 4.1% |
